Materials

Burnman operates on materials (type Material) most prominently in the form of minerals (Mineral) and composites (Composite).

Inheritance diagram of burnman.Material, burnman.Mineral, burnman.PerplexMaterial, burnman.SolidSolution, burnman.Composite, burnman.CombinedMineral, burnman.AnisotropicMaterial, burnman.AnisotropicMineral

Material Base Class

class burnman.Material[source]

Bases: object

Base class for all materials. The main functionality is unroll() which returns a list of objects of type Mineral and their molar fractions. This class is available as burnman.Material.

The user needs to call set_method() (once in the beginning) and set_state() before querying the material with unroll() or density().

Perple_X Class

class burnman.PerplexMaterial(tab_file, name='Perple_X material')[source]

Bases: burnman.classes.material.Material

This is the base class for a PerpleX material. States of the material can only be queried after setting the pressure and temperature using set_state().

Instances of this class are initialised with a 2D PerpleX tab file. This file should be in the standard format (as output by werami), and should have columns with the following names: ‘rho,kg/m3’, ‘alpha,1/K’, ‘beta,1/bar’, ‘Ks,bar’, ‘Gs,bar’, ‘v0,km/s’, ‘vp,km/s’, ‘vs,km/s’, ‘s,J/K/kg’, ‘h,J/kg’, ‘cp,J/K/kg’, ‘V,J/bar/mol’. The order of these names is not important.

Properties of the material are determined by linear interpolation from the PerpleX grid. They are all returned in SI units on a molar basis, even though the PerpleX tab file is not in these units.

This class is available as burnman.PerplexMaterial.

Minerals

Endmembers

class burnman.Mineral(params=None, property_modifiers=None)[source]

Bases: burnman.classes.material.Material

This is the base class for all minerals. States of the mineral can only be queried after setting the pressure and temperature using set_state(). The method for computing properties of the material is set using set_method(). This is done during initialisation if the param ‘equation_of_state’ has been defined. The method can be overridden later by the user.

This class is available as burnman.Mineral.

If deriving from this class, set the properties in self.params to the desired values. For more complicated materials you can overwrite set_state(), change the params and then call set_state() from this class.

All the material parameters are expected to be in plain SI units. This means that the elastic moduli should be in Pascals and NOT Gigapascals, and the Debye temperature should be in K not C. Additionally, the reference volume should be in m^3/(mol molecule) and not in unit cell volume and ‘n’ should be the number of atoms per molecule. Frequently in the literature the reference volume is given in Angstrom^3 per unit cell. To convert this to m^3/(mol of molecule) you should multiply by 10^(-30) * N_a / Z, where N_a is Avogadro’s number and Z is the number of formula units per unit cell. You can look up Z in many places, including www.mindat.org

set_method(equation_of_state)[source]

Set the equation of state to be used for this mineral. Takes a string corresponding to any of the predefined equations of state: ‘bm2’, ‘bm3’, ‘mgd2’, ‘mgd3’, ‘slb2’, ‘slb3’, ‘mt’, ‘hp_tmt’, or ‘cork’. Alternatively, you can pass a user defined class which derives from the equation_of_state base class. After calling set_method(), any existing derived properties (e.g., elastic parameters or thermodynamic potentials) will be out of date, so set_state() will need to be called again.

Solid solutions

class burnman.SolidSolution(name=None, solution_type=None, endmembers=None, energy_interaction=None, volume_interaction=None, entropy_interaction=None, energy_ternary_terms=None, volume_ternary_terms=None, entropy_ternary_terms=None, alphas=None, molar_fractions=None)[source]

Bases: burnman.classes.mineral.Mineral

This is the base class for all solid solutions. Site occupancies, endmember activities and the constant and pressure and temperature dependencies of the excess properties can be queried after using set_composition() States of the solid solution can only be queried after setting the pressure, temperature and composition using set_state().

This class is available as burnman.SolidSolution. It uses an instance of burnman.SolutionModel to calculate interaction terms between endmembers.

All the solid solution parameters are expected to be in SI units. This means that the interaction parameters should be in J/mol, with the T and P derivatives in J/K/mol and m^3/mol.

The parameters are relevant to all solution models. Please see the documentation for individual models for details about other parameters.

Parameters
namestring

Name of the solid solution

solution_typestring

String determining which SolutionModel to use. One of ‘mechanical’, ‘ideal’, ‘symmetric’, ‘asymmetric’ or ‘subregular’.

endmemberslist of lists

List of endmembers in this solid solution. The first item of each list should be a burnman.Mineral object. The second item should be a string with the site formula of the endmember.

molar_fractionsnumpy array (optional)

The molar fractions of each endmember in the solid solution. Can be reset using the set_composition() method.

Anisotropic materials

class burnman.AnisotropicMaterial(rho, cijs)[source]

Bases: burnman.classes.material.Material

A base class for anisotropic elastic materials. The base class is initialised with a density and a full isentropic stiffness tensor in Voigt notation. It can then be interrogated to find the values of different properties, such as bounds on seismic velocities. There are also several functions which can be called to calculate properties along directions oriented with respect to the isentropic elastic tensor.

See [MHS11] and https://docs.materialsproject.org/methodology/elasticity/ for mathematical descriptions of each function.

class burnman.AnisotropicMineral(isotropic_mineral, cell_parameters, anisotropic_parameters)[source]

Bases: burnman.classes.mineral.Mineral, burnman.classes.anisotropy.AnisotropicMaterial

A class implementing the anisotropic mineral equation of state described in [Myh21]. This class is derived from both Mineral and AnisotropicMaterial, and inherits most of the methods from these classes.

Instantiation of an AnisotropicMineral takes three arguments; a reference Mineral (i.e. a standard isotropic mineral which provides volume as a function of pressure and temperature), cell_parameters, which give the lengths of the molar cell vectors and the angles between them (see cell_parameters_to_vectors()), and a 4D array of anisotropic parameters which describe the anisotropic behaviour of the mineral. For a description of the physical meaning of these parameters, please refer to the code or to the original paper.

States of the mineral can only be queried after setting the pressure and temperature using set_state().

This class is available as burnman.AnisotropicMineral.

All the material parameters are expected to be in plain SI units. This means that the elastic moduli should be in Pascals and NOT Gigapascals. Additionally, the cell parameters should be in m/(mol formula unit) and not in unit cell lengths. To convert unit cell lengths given in Angstrom to molar cell parameters you should multiply by 10^(-10) * (N_a / Z)^1/3, where N_a is Avogadro’s number and Z is the number of formula units per unit cell. You can look up Z in many places, including www.mindat.org.

Finally, it is assumed that the unit cell of the anisotropic material is aligned in a particular way relative to the coordinate axes (the anisotropic_parameters are defined relative to the coordinate axes). The crystallographic a-axis is assumed to be parallel to the first spatial coordinate axis, and the crystallographic b-axis is assumed to be perpendicular to the third spatial coordinate axis.

burnman.cell_parameters_to_vectors(cell_parameters)[source]

Converts cell parameters to unit cell vectors.

Parameters
cell_parameters1D numpy array

An array containing the three lengths of the unit cell vectors [m], and the three angles [degrees]. The first angle (\(\alpha\)) corresponds to the angle between the second and the third cell vectors, the second (\(\beta\)) to the angle between the first and third cell vectors, and the third (\(\gamma\)) to the angle between the first and second vectors.

Returns
M2D numpy array

The three vectors defining the parallelopiped cell [m]. This function assumes that the first cell vector is colinear with the x-axis, and the second is perpendicular to the z-axis, and the third is defined in a right-handed sense.

Composites

class burnman.Composite(phases, fractions=None, fraction_type='molar', name='Unnamed composite')[source]

Bases: burnman.classes.material.Material

Base class for a composite material. The static phases can be minerals or materials, meaning composite can be nested arbitrarily.

The fractions of the phases can be input as either ‘molar’ or ‘mass’ during instantiation, and modified (or initialised) after this point by using set_fractions.

This class is available as burnman.Composite.
